Factors Driving Global Demand

Several key factors contribute to the increasing global demand for sunglasses. First and foremost, awareness of eye protection and UV safety has risen sharply. Consumers understand that prolonged exposure to ultraviolet rays can cause cataracts, macular degeneration, and other eye-related issues. This knowledge has heightened the importance of quality sunglasses that provide adequate UV protection, driving sales across multiple demographics.

Fashion trends also play a significant role in shaping demand. Sunglasses are a prominent accessory in global fashion, with seasonal collections, celebrity endorsements, and social media influence contributing to consumer interest. As eyewear becomes a statement of personal style, brands are compelled to innovate with unique frame shapes, colors, and lens technologies, further fueling demand.

Economic growth and increasing disposable income in emerging markets have also contributed to the expansion of the sunglasses sector. Countries in Asia, the Middle East, and Latin America are experiencing rising purchasing power, allowing more consumers to invest in quality eyewear. This growth, coupled with urbanization and the popularity of outdoor activities, creates a favorable environment for both mass-market and premium sunglasses manufacturers.

Manufacturing Expansion and Technological Innovation

The growing market demand has encouraged sunglasses manufacturers to scale up production while improving precision and efficiency. Advanced manufacturing technologies, such as computer-aided design (CAD), 3D printing, and CNC machining, enable manufacturers to create complex frame designs and custom lens shapes with high accuracy. Automation in lens cutting, polishing, and assembly ensures consistency and reduces production costs, allowing manufacturers to meet large-scale demand without compromising quality.

Additionally, manufacturers are increasingly adopting sustainable production practices to align with consumer preferences for eco-friendly products. This includes the use of recycled or bio-based materials, water-based coatings, and energy-efficient manufacturing processes. Sustainability not only reduces environmental impact but also enhances brand reputation and appeal in markets where eco-conscious consumers are growing in number.

Global Distribution and Market Reach

Distribution channels are another factor driving growth in sunglasses manufacturing. Traditional retail stores, department stores, and specialty eyewear shops remain important, but e-commerce has dramatically expanded manufacturers’ reach. Online sales platforms allow brands to connect with consumers worldwide, offer customizable options, and introduce limited-edition collections efficiently.

Wholesale and bulk distribution also play a crucial role. Manufacturers supply retailers, fashion brands, and promotional partners with large quantities of eyewear, enabling brands to maintain consistent market presence and meet seasonal demand spikes. The combination of retail, online, and wholesale channels ensures that manufacturers can cater to a diverse and growing global customer base.

Challenges in Meeting Market Demand

Despite the growth opportunities, sunglasses manufacturers face several challenges. Fluctuations in raw material prices, supply chain disruptions, and international trade regulations can affect production timelines and costs. Maintaining consistent quality across large volumes of products is another challenge, especially when introducing complex designs or new technologies. To overcome these challenges, manufacturers invest in strategic sourcing, quality control systems, and supply chain optimization.

Furthermore, evolving consumer preferences require manufacturers to be agile and responsive. Trends in lens technology, frame materials, and design aesthetics change rapidly, demanding flexibility in production and product development. Those manufacturers capable of balancing innovation with operational efficiency are more likely to succeed in the competitive global market.
